js中添加事件監聽本來是非常常見的事情,但是去除監聽一般很少去干,最近項目中需要監聽頁面顯示或者隱藏 代碼如下 參考文章如下:https://blog.csdn.net/xiasohuai/article/details/83063293 ...
addEventListener 方法: addEventListener 方法為指定元素指定事件處理程序。 addEventListener 方法為元素附加事件處理程序而不會覆蓋已有的事件處理程序。 您能夠向一個元素添加多個事件處理程序。 您能夠向一個元素添加多個相同類型的事件處理程序,例如兩個 click 事件。 您能夠向任何 DOM 對象添加事件處理程序而非僅僅 HTML 元素,例如 wi ...
2019-07-03 11:41 0 2102 推薦指數:
js中添加事件監聽本來是非常常見的事情,但是去除監聽一般很少去干,最近項目中需要監聽頁面顯示或者隱藏 代碼如下 參考文章如下:https://blog.csdn.net/xiasohuai/article/details/83063293 ...
<div id="id1" style="width:200px; height:200px; position:absolute; top:100px; left:100px; back ...
Js之on和addEventListener的使用與不同 一.首先介紹兩者的用法: 1.on的用法:以onclick為例 第一種: 第二種: 第三種:當函數 ...
先看這段代碼 會發現focus這個操作還未執行,i的值已被依次打印出來。 如何傳入傳參函數而不被立即執行呢,方法一:給addEventListener綁定一個匿名函數。 tip:綁定匿名函數的話不能使用removeEventListener移除事件。 方法 ...
如果為了避免 js addEventListener事件多次綁定問題,可以使用.onclick直接綁定,后一次click綁定會覆蓋調前一次。 ...
js中,我們可以給一個dom對象添加監聽事件,函數就是 addEventListener("click",function(){},true); 很容易理解,第一個參數是事件類型,比如點擊(click)、觸摸(touchstart), 第二個參數就是事件函數, 比如我給一個button添加 ...
一般我們在JS中添加事件,是這樣子的 obj.onclick=method 這種綁定事件的方式,兼容主流瀏覽器,但如果一個元素上添加多次同一事件呢? obj.onclick=method1; obj.onclick=method2; obj.onclick=method3; 如果這樣寫 ...
最近在寫js的類庫,模仿的是jquery的編程風格,當封裝到事件監聽的時候發現遇到了一個問題,代碼是這樣的: 上面是封裝的一個事件委托的代碼,我以為上面的封裝跟普通的事件監聽一樣簡單,結果我在調用時發現報錯: 為什么會報這樣的錯,原來是不同於單一的onclick之類的事件 ...